Whitecourt's Business Support Network provides support to employers through a forum that shares ideas, exchanges information on current labour market trends and provides an opportunity to identify and support solutions to address workforce issues.
The Whitecourt Business Support Network is hosting industry specific speaker series that will feature a specific industry each month to provide employers with tangible best practice toolkits to enhance workforce attraction and retention practices.
